Surface Preparation
Before repainting your home, see to it to extensively prepare the surface areas by cleaning and fixing any type of blemishes. Start by washing the walls with a light cleaning agent remedy to remove dirt, dust, and grease. Utilize a sponge or fabric to scrub gently, ensuring all surfaces are tidy and completely dry before proceeding.
Evaluate the walls for any kind of splits, holes, or peeling off paint. Fill out any type of voids with spackling compound, sanding it smooth when dry. For larger holes, take into consideration using a patch set for a smooth finish.
Next off, carefully inspect the trim, walls, and crown molding. Wipe them down with a moist fabric to eliminate any kind of grime or residue. Look for any damages or scrapes that need to be filled and fined sand.
Don't forget the ceilings-- tidy them completely and deal with any type of blemishes prior to paint.
Color and Finish Selection
To achieve the preferred visual for your home, thoroughly select the shades and surfaces that will improve the general look and feel of each room. When picking colors, think about the mood you intend to develop in each space. Lighter shades can make an area feel more roomy and airy, while darker tones can include warmth and coziness. Think about the natural light that goes into the space and just how it might influence the shade throughout the day.

Relocate furnishings to the center of the room or into another area away from the walls being painted. If moving large items isn't feasible, team them together and cover with safety materials.
For smaller sized decor pieces, remove them from the room completely if practical. If eliminating them isn't an option, very carefully wrap them in plastic or towel to prevent paint damages.
Pay unique interest to electronics and beneficial things that could be easily spoiled by paint.
Don't forget your flooring. Set protective coverings like rosin paper or textile drop cloths to protect carpets, wood floorings, or ceramic tiles from paint splatters. Safeguard the treatments in position with painter's tape to avoid any type of mishaps while the paint is in progression.
Taking these precautions will certainly aid ensure that your furniture, decoration, and floors stay in top condition during the expert painting process.
